In a strategic move to revolutionize emergency response times, Maharashtra has begun piloting a new fleet of e-bike paramedics across key urban and semi-urban regions. This innovative approach aims to bypass congested traffic routes, allowing trained medical responders to reach patients in critical need faster than traditional ambulances.

The initiative, launched in early 2025, is being rolled out under the state’s emergency health modernization program. With densely populated areas like Mumbai, Pune, and Nagpur often crippled by traffic snarls, this step intends to plug a crucial gap in last-mile emergency response.

How E-Bike Paramedics Are Changing the Emergency Landscape

E-bike paramedics, outfitted with essential medical gear and GPS tracking systems, are designed to function as first responders in time-sensitive cases such as cardiac arrests, accidents, and strokes. The compact design and zero-emission nature of electric bikes make them ideal for navigating narrow lanes and gridlocked roads.

Each rider is a trained healthcare professional capable of administering CPR, using automated external defibrillators (AEDs), and managing trauma on-site. These rapid responders act as a bridge until a full-service ambulance can reach the location.

The Technology and Training Behind the Rollout

The electric bikes are powered by high-capacity lithium-ion batteries offering a range of up to 120 kilometers per charge. Each unit is integrated with real-time GPS, enabling coordination with control rooms and ensuring precise deployment.

Paramedics selected for the project undergo specialized training not only in emergency medical care but also in bike handling and safety. The government has partnered with multiple health tech companies to monitor data on response times, case types, and overall efficacy.

The program’s digital backbone is equally impressive. An AI-based dispatch system helps prioritize emergencies based on severity and location, ensuring the nearest available E-bike paramedic is routed in seconds.

Why This Matters Now More Than Ever

With rising urban populations and strained healthcare infrastructure, the traditional ambulance system often falls short, especially during peak hours. According to the Maharashtra State Health Department, nearly 30% of emergency calls in metro cities are delayed due to logistical issues.

E-bike paramedics are a strategic response to this growing crisis. Their ability to bypass common obstacles in urban areas significantly improves the chances of patient survival in golden-hour scenarios. Moreover, with their lower operational footprint, they present a sustainable model for other Indian states to emulate.

Future Plans and Public Reception

The government plans to evaluate the pilot’s performance over the next six months before scaling it statewide. Feedback from the initial rollout has been largely positive, with both citizens and healthcare professionals praising the increased agility in medical response.

Plans are also underway to equip E-bike paramedics with wearable tech and live video support from doctors at central command centers. This could dramatically boost the quality of care administered before patients even reach a hospital.
